Transaction 620e4a2e3c58c144d714a95012f50d59639fc4d864d4832bd6147fce3bd99f9e

1 Input
2 Outputs
  • 620e4a2e3c58c144d714a95012f50d59639fc4d864d4832bd6147fce3bd99f9e:0
  • value  870308
    address  1Jh9KuShxA9dhUpVeBSSitGMw973f1PtFW
  • 620e4a2e3c58c144d714a95012f50d59639fc4d864d4832bd6147fce3bd99f9e:1
  • value  7349050
    address  1N74oBBiXfmxWaYtPfAvB7C4kQM1iaEuZa